Introducing Ji Oh A/W 2014 collection

Introducing Ji Oh A/W 2014 collection

With more new designers than designs on the scene this season, it takes true talent to create a collection that wows. Cue Ji Oh, a Korean-born fashion prodigy whose 2014 fall collection has caused an international storm. Channelling minimalism, the idea behind the design is for women to “not be defined by their clothes”.ji oh 1

The key colours for the collection are blacks, whites and greys, with a couple of red pieces thrown in for good measure. The blocky shapes and lack of detail support the idea of expression through character, not clothes, yet still manage to exude effortless chic. The theme is very Pierre Cardin circa 1968 with a bit of added androgyny to spin it into the 21st century.ji oh 2 

Ultimately, Ji Oh has re-introduced that old school minimalistic style that slips quite easily into anyone’s closet, presenting key pieces that are timeless and versatile – a winning combination! The designer is fast becoming an international success, so watch this space.
